Expense scanning into QuickBooks, with a human approval gate.
The job today: Someone collects receipts and invoices, reads each one, and types the supplier, date, amount, and tax into QuickBooks by hand. It is slow, dull, and easy to get wrong, and it usually piles up until the end of the month.
What the tool does: Receipts arrive by photo, upload, or forwarded email. The AI reads each one and extracts the supplier, date, total, tax, and category, then prepares the entry ready for QuickBooks. Instead of posting straight away, it places the entry in an approval queue.
Where you stay in control: A person opens the queue, sees each prepared entry next to the original receipt, and approves or corrects it in a click. Nothing posts to your accounts until a human says yes. Corrections teach the tool to do better next time.
Your own knowledge base, built from your documents and emails.
The job today: The answer someone needs is in an old email, a policy document, a spec, or a folder nobody can find. Staff interrupt each other, dig through inboxes, or simply guess. Knowledge lives in a few people's heads and walks out the door when they do.
What the tool does: We take the documents, emails, and files your business already has and build them into a private, searchable knowledge base, effectively your own internal intranet. Staff ask a question in everyday language and get a clear answer drawn from your own material, with the source it came from shown so they can trust it. As new documents and emails come in, they feed the knowledge base, so it stays current.
Where you stay in control: You decide what goes in and what stays out. Answers are grounded in your real content, not the open internet, and every answer shows its source so a person can verify it. Your information stays private to your business.
